Different types of trading

There are many types of trading platforms for crypto exchanges. All of them offer a variety digital currencies. Most exchanges work as brokers for buyers and investors. These exchanges allow users to deposit money to buy crypto currency and trade it with other cryptocurrencies. These exchanges also allow you to convert your cryptocurrencies back to regular currency, and many of them accept a variety of payment methods. You can pick the type of trading that you like.

Experienced users will find more trading pairs on crypto-tocrypto exchanges. CoinBene is one example of a retail exchange. They manage trades via a central ordering book. P2P exchanges, on the other hand, are made for individual users. You can create a public listing to promote a particular cryptocurrency. Other users can then respond. These types of exchanges offer a number of benefits, including lower transaction costs and access to a large range of trading pairs.

Trading volume

A key indicator of popularity is trading volume on a crypto-exchange. This can be used to spot price breakouts and trend shifts, as well as for other purposes. The bar chart can display trading volume depending on the cryptocurrency exchange. However, it is important to note that trading volume on a single exchange does not necessarily indicate popularity across all exchanges. You can look at the trading volume and see how popular a specific cryptocurrency is over time.

Can I trade Bitcoins on margins?

You can trade Bitcoin on margin. Margin trades allow you to borrow additional money against your existing holdings. If you borrow more money you will pay interest on top.

How can you mine cryptocurrency?

Although the first blockchains were intended to record Bitcoin transactions, today many other cryptocurrencies are available, including Ethereum, Ripple and Dogecoin. Mining is required in order to secure these blockchains and put new coins in circulation.

Proof-of-work is a method of mining. This method allows miners to compete against one another to solve cryptographic puzzles. Newly minted coins are awarded to miners who solve cryptographic puzzles.
